APP ====================================================== CORAM: HONOURABLE MR. JUSTICE MOHIT KUMAR SHAH ORAL ORDER 11-01-2019 Heard the learned counsel for the petitioner and the learned counsel for the State.
The petitioner seeks regular bail in connection with Bisfi PS case no. 123 of 2017 registered for the offence punishable under Sections 363, 366(A), 328, 376(D), 120(B)/34 of Indian Penal Code and Section 4 of POCSO Act. The case of the prosecution is that the prosecutrix had gone out of the house for the purposes of getting her cloth stitched and on the way, the petitioner and one other co-accused namely Kapil had waylaid her and taken her to Nepal, however subsequently, she was left at her aunt's place by the said accused persons.

No.69700 of 2018(3) dt.11-01-2019 2/2 The learned counsel for the petitioner submits that admittedly, no immoral act has been committed by the petitioner and the entire story appears to be concocted one. It is further submitted that the petitioner is having a clean antecedent and he is languishing in custody since 03.08.2018. Having regard to the facts and circumstances of the case, I deem it fit and proper to enlarge the petitioner on regular bail.
Accordingly, the abovenamed petitioner is directed to be enlarged on regular bail on furnishing bail bond of Rs. 10,000/- (rupees ten thousand) with two sureties of the like amount each to the satisfaction of 1st Addl. Sessions Judge-cumSpecial Judge, POCSO Act, Madhubani in connection with Bisfi PS case no. 123 of 2017.
